@
Junzhou 赞同你说的。对普通人来说,学基础知识和技能更有性价比。
@
SunshinePlanet 跑个题。看到楼主的发帖想到年轻时候的自己,感慨一下时间过得好快。作为一个大学生活和楼主差不多(想法也差不多),现在靠算法吃饭的屌丝来说,回过头看看,ACM 竞赛内容真的只是计算机科学很小的一块。
我的经历和 @
DeleteZN 差不多,还不如他哈哈哈。我大学的时候没有打过 ACM 和 CTF,经常看和折腾的乱七八糟的东西。不过这些还有学校的基础课受用到现在,陪我一路走来直到出国,直到我现在还会经常翻翻大学的经典教材(感谢老师推荐的经典书)。
在国外,我的朋友找工作也是经常刷 Leecode,确实有公司会参考但是并不所有的都是,只是一种证明能力的途径。反正我是没有被问(摊手)而且我现在依旧是这个习惯,折腾自己喜欢的,看自己想看的。不想自己的创造力和学习兴趣被磨灭。
不用和别人走一样的路,别人或者老师怎么想和做和你都没什么关系。喜欢刷题就刷题,不喜欢就不做,做自己喜欢的,创造力和学习的 motivation 比奖牌更重要。能力的证明有很多种,不是只有奖牌,努力付出都会有结果的。我的经历算是给楼主一些鼓励,祝好,加油💪。